Catherine Ann Saathoff (Cathy) passed away on March 29, 2019 in League City, Texas after a courageous battle with ovarian cancer. She was born June 8, 1937 in San Antonio, Texas to Lucille and Fred Thomas. She graduated from Burbank High School in San Antonio and promptly married her childhood friend and love of her life, Donald Ray Saathoff. And off they went to the University of Texas and around the country to start and grow a family. Cathy was a very sweet tough cookie - she loved her family and friends immensely and survived many trials: being born 3 months premature, a pitchfork through the foot, a chainsaw to the hand and many falls. She always got up and thrived. She was such a strong and loving Mom and Grandma who loved her family with all her heart. She loved to shop and to give, particularly to her grandkids. She was bursting with energy and pursued many hobbies: painting and decoupaging, painting and firing ceramics, splashing avocado green on all sorts of furniture, sewing, reading and gardening. Oh yeah - and rearranging everything! 

Mom also loved to fish at the Texas coast and elsewhere. She enjoyed being on Dennis' boat with her dog, Maggie. She was also a "theme park aficionado", buying many annual passes to SeaWorld for her loved ones and visiting Disney World.

Mom had a special quality of innocence, a fresh enthusiasm. Her friends called her the Energizer Bunny. She loved getting the "neat stuff" for her kids and grandkids and loved to find the coolest stuff for the Christmas stockings - stockings hand-made by her and her mother.

Cathy was preceded in death by her husband, Donald Ray Saathoff, married 54 years. She is survived by her sons Don Saathoff, Jr. (Carolyn), Dennis Saathoff, Tommy Saathoff, her daughter Tammy Saathoff, sister-in-law Elaine Hambright (Robert) and family, grandchildren Shauna Gordon (Travis), Tyler Saathoff, Jillian Saathoff, Toby Saathoff and Trenton Saathoff. She was loved by all and was a ton of fun, even close to the end.
